Harbin Train Station, August 26. Not much more information is given on this video posted earlier this week, but the uniformed man appears to be a chengguan — urban management officer — and we’re told the old man is a beggar. No word on what caused this scuffle, or why the chengguan seems so incensed. (Pointing a finger at someone, the way the officer does here, is a terrible insult in this culture.) All we know is that we’re not terribly surprised: uniformed man beating up a homeless man? Chengguan would, of course. Youku video for those in China after the jump.
Post Stream

November 5, 2013 2:16 am

May 14, 2013 3:21 pm

March 14, 2013 12:37 pm

January 30, 2013 1:29 pm

November 20, 2012 2:00 pm

October 23, 2012 1:00 pm

June 19, 2012 2:35 pm

September 26, 2017 3:45 pm

July 27, 2017 2:09 am
Lots of finger pointing… hahaha!
chinese super dog